GE Power Conversion, a part of GE Vernova, specializes in the conversion of electrical energy for various industrial applications. The company designs and delivers advanced motor, drive, and control technologies that contribute to the electrification and energy transition across multiple sectors.

As a Contract Manager, you will be responsible for overseeing the entire lifecycle of contracts within the organization. This includes drafting, evaluating, negotiating, and executing contracts to ensure they meet legal requirements and align with company goals. The Contract Manager will work closely with various departments to manage contractual obligations and mitigate risks.

Roles and responsibilities:

  • Draft, review, negotiate and amend contracts, and bring support to internal teams, including commercial, legal, and sourcing (e.g. civil works, public procurement, etc.) .
  • Lead communications, notices and claims towards Customers and supplier
  • Maintain strong partnership with Project Management and Supply Chain teams
  • Ensure all contracts comply with legal and regulatory requirements.
  • Maintain accurate records of all contract-related documents and communications.
  • Identify potential risks & opportunities in contract terms and conditions.
  • Develop strategies to mitigate contractual risks.
  • Monitor compliance with contractual obligations and address any issues promptly (Planning deviations, performance gaps, budget overrun, scope creep)
  • Work with and be part of internal teams, including legal, finance, engineering and project management, to ensure contract terms are understood and adhered to.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for contract-related inquiries, claims management, and disputes.
  • Maintain coordination over consortium / JV partners, channels.
  • Continuously improve contract management processes (including handovers), policies and procedures to enhance efficiency and effectiveness.
  • Continuously improve Claim Risk tracker reporting to enhance customer claim monitoring and adequate flow down to vendors.
  • Raise awareness and train our project teams about best practices in terms of contact management.
  • Prepare regular reports on contract status, compliance, and performance.
  • Analyze contract data to identify trends and areas for improvement.
  • Lead contract reviews

GE Vernova is a purpose-built energy technology company on a mission to electrify and decarbonize the world.It is made up of three businesses -- Power, Wind, and Electrification -- with focus on accelerating the path to more reliable, affordable, and sustainable energy, while helping our customers power economies and deliver the electricity that is vital to health, safety, security, and improved quality of life.The world needs more energy, smarter energy. With energy demand expected to grow by more than 50% in the next 20 years, we are continuously innovating to meet the moment…like we have for the past 130 years. The Energy of Change and relentless optimism are what drive us – it’s about never giving up and seeing what’s possible so that we deliver the energy technologies the world needs right now and for generations to come.GE Vernova’s attitude and edge is embedded in its name. We retain our treasured legacy, “GE,” as an enduring and hard-earned badge of quality and ingenuity. “Ver” / “verde” signal Earth’s verdant and lush ecosystems. “Nova,” from the Latin “novus,” nods to a new, innovative era of lower carbon energy that GE Vernova will help deliver.Together, we have the energy to change the world.
